About Tulsa, OK
As a travel nurse in Tulsa, OK here's what you should know:- Tulsa's cost of living is 16% lower than the national average, making it an affordable place to live.
- Wages generally match up with the lower cost of living, providing a good balance for residents.
- Summer average highs are around 92°F, and winter average lows are around 26°F, offering a mix of seasons for those who enjoy variety.
- Short term rentals are relatively easy to find in Tulsa, with various options available for travel nurses.
- Tulsa is car-friendly with easy access to major highways.
- Public transportation options are available but may not be as extensive as in larger cities.
- Tulsa has a diverse population with a wide age range.
- Common health issues may include obesity and related conditions.
- There is a growing population of travel nurses due to the presence of several healthcare facilities.
- Tulsa offers a variety of activities including dining at local restaurants, exploring art and music at museums, enjoying outdoor activities at parks, and engaging in sports such as golf.
- The city has a vibrant cultural scene with something for everyone.
